Abstract EN
Prune belly syndrome (PBS) is a rare congenital anomaly characterized in males by a triad of anomalous genitourinary tract, deficient development of abdominal wall muscles, and bilateral cryptorchidism.
Although similar anomalies have been reported in females, by definition they do not full fill the classical triad.
Urorectal septum malformation sequence (URSM) is a lethal condition characterized by presence of ambiguous genitalia, absent perineal openings (urogenital and anal), and lumbosacral abnormalities.
In this original case report, the authors discuss the presentation and management of what would be analogous to a Woodhouse category 1 PBS in a female newborn associated with an overlapping presentation of URSM.
